Blinded by Ideology, Congressional Democrats Choose Politics Over Public Safety

House Representative Young Kim (R‑CA) spearheaded a House resolution (H. Res. 516) condemning the violent unrest in Los Angeles that erupted after ICE deportation raids, garnering unanimous support from California’s Republican delegation. The measure strongly denounced acts of arson, vandalism, and assaults on officers under the guise of protest, praised the constitutional right to peaceful assembly, and urged state and local officials, including Governor Newsom and LA Mayor Bass, to collaborate with federal and local law enforcement to restore order.

In a procedural roll call (H. Res. 530) providing for consideration of H. Res. 516 condemning the violent June 2025 riots in Los Angeles, California, it appears that the Democrats wanted to avoid the issue by voting 206 against being placed on the House Calendar for further debate and consideration.  Vote1(206 Democrats voted against it, zero for it, and six abstained.)

The resolution’s introduction spotlighted stark party divisions over law enforcement, but whether it passed or failed remains pending on the House floor.
